Maggi Packets Eaten in Indian Hostels Daily
Scope it first — questions to ask
- · What counts as a hostel? — College/university hostels plus student PGs; exclude school boarding houses.
- · What's the unit? — Standard 70g packet, whether cooked in-room or at the night canteen.
- · Average day or exam season? — A normal average day.
Assumptions on the table
- · India higher-education enrollment ≈ 40M — AISHE ballpark of 4+ crore students.
- · ~25% of students live in hostels/PGs (the rest are day scholars) — typical residential share.
- · ~70% of hostellers eat Maggi at all — it is the default late-night snack, but not universal.
- · Eaters average ~1.5 packets a week — a weekly habit plus exam-night spikes, not a daily one.
